"We
pedal south from Raymond's shop, past the Chapel of Our Lady
of the Pines, up an old red-dirt logging road, and into woods
spiced with the scent of white pine. He leads me on rolling
singletrack, past birches and thimbleberry bushes, beaver
ponds and tea-colored creeks. We hop logs and bounce on smooth
conglomorate- the Keweenaw version of slickrock. We top a
ridge, and Raymond points out the Estivant Pines, a protected
patch of old-growth white pine that once blanketed the Upper
Peninsula. The trees tower a hundred feet above the surrounding
canopy, like circus clowns on stilts." -
a quote from National Geographic Adventure Magazine,
August 2002. |

To
the Point (intermediate / advanced) |
|
| |
With
a 2 person minimum; $35 per person w/ own bike. $65/ person with Kona hardtail mountain bike rental. $75 per person
w/ Kona or Marin dual suspension mountain bike rental.
TRAILS: Logging roads, two track and a bit of singletrack.
TOUR LENGTH: 3 to 5 hours. 20-30 miles
Explore the uninhabited tip of Michigan and area surrounding
Keweenaw Point. We will visit remote Lake Superior shoreline
including the nature preserve at Horseshoe Harbor and "Lands
End" at Highrock Bay. We will then climb a bluff over 700 feet
for a panoramic view of "the tip" and Lake Superior from the
top. A spin on rolling logging roads and a bit of singletrack
will loop us into the decent back into Copper Harbor. Now that
you've rode the rest, get to the Point! |
